Chapter 3 — NONRESIDENTIAL, HOTEL/MOTEL OCCUPANCIES, AND COVERED PROCESSES—MANDATORY REQUIREMENTS

Section 120.10 — MANDATORY REQUIREMENTS FOR FANS

2025 California Energy Code (Title 24, Part 6) · 2025 edition · updated 2026-07-25 · California

(a) Each fan or fan array with a combined motor nameplate horsepower greater than 1.00 hp or with a combined fan nameplate electrical input power greater than 0.89 kW shall have a fan energy index (FEI) of 1.00 or higher at fan system design conditions. Each fan and fan array used for a variable-air-volume system that meets the requirements of Section 140.4(c)2 shall have an FEI of 0.95 or higher at fan system design conditions.

  1. The FEI for fan arrays shall be calculated in accordance with ANSI/AMCA 208-18 Annex C.
  2. All FEI values shall be provided by a manufacturer, where fan selection software and/or fan catalogs display third-partyverified FEI values in accordance with Appendix A to Subpart J of Part 10 CFR 431. Exception to Section 120.10(a)2: FEI values for embedded fans do not need to be third-party verified.

Exception 1 to Section 120.10(a): Embedded fans that are part of the equipment listed under Section 110.1 or Section 110.2, computer room air conditioners (CRACs) as defined in 10 CFR 431, and DX-DOAS units.

Exception 2 to Section 120.10(a): Embedded fans and embedded fan arrays with a combined motor nameplate horsepower of 5 hp or less or with a fan system electrical input power of 4.1 kW or less.

Exception 3 to Section 120.10(a): Circulation fans, ceiling fans and air curtains.

Exception 4 to Section 120.10(a): Fans that are intended to operate only during emergency conditions.
